Project Management Course Explained:

The execution of values such as Planning, Organizing, Inspiring, and Regulating resources to accomplish definite objectives and success is known as Project Management.

Initiating, Organizing, Implementing, Monitoring and Controlling, Closure, Social and Professional responsibility are the 6 important domains that it covers.

After successful completion of the PMP Course, the PMP designation is offered by the PMI- Professional Management Institute. It is one of the most deemed designations all around the world and it is accepted worldwide beyond different industries such as IT, Manufacturing, Retail, Civil industry etc.

PMP Certification Eligibility:

You must meet the following PMP requirements in order to be qualified to take the PMP certification exam:

A 4-year degree combined with 35 hours of project management training or CAPM certification and 36 months of managing projects

                                                          OR

A graduation from a high school or an associate’s degree, 60 months of project management experience, and the CAPM certification after 35 hours of project management training.

Preparation with Latest PMBOK Guide:

The international standard for project management is the Project Management Body of Knowledge (PMBOK). A Guide to the Project Management Body of Knowledge, which details how the PMBOK has changed through time (or PMBOK Guide).

For those aiming to earn a Project Management Professional certification, PMBOK is the holy book. This book includes all the necessary information and guidelines to pass the exam. The PMBOK, which is updated with each new version of the Guide, serves as the foundation for the PMP exam. You must therefore keep up with the most recent edition of the PMBOK Guide if you want to comprehend how practices and knowledge are changing. It will be very beneficial for the PMP exam.

Mock tests to prepare for the PMP exam:

Mock exams are an excellent tool to assess your level of preparation for any exam and determine which areas require substantial last-minute revision. When you take lots of PMP practice exams, you’ll also become more effective when taking the real test. It will assist you in developing sound time management skills. Training programs typically offer a variety of practice exams to help in your preparation.
